How much do electronics engineering technologist jobs pay per year?

As of Aug 31, 2026, the average yearly pay for electronics engineering technologist in Connecticut is $75,508.00, according to ZipRecruiter salary data. Most workers in this role earn between $66,600.00 and $83,700.00 per year, depending on experience, location, and employer.

What is an electronics engineering technologist?

Electronics Engineering Technologists are professionals who assist engineers in designing, developing, testing, and maintaining electronic equipment such as communication systems, control systems, and consumer electronics. They apply their in-depth knowledge of electronics theory and practical skills to install, troubleshoot, and repair complex electronic systems. Typically, they work in industries like manufacturing, telecommunications, and research and development, often bridging the gap between engineering theory and hands-on application. Their work ensures that electronic devices and systems operate efficiently and reliably.

What are the key skills and qualifications needed to thrive as an electronics engineering technologist, and why are they important?

To thrive as an Electronics Engineering Technologist, you need a solid understanding of electronic circuits, troubleshooting, and instrumentation, typically gained through a relevant diploma or degree. Familiarity with CAD software, programmable logic controllers (PLCs), and electronic testing equipment is often required, along with certifications like CET (Certified Engineering Technologist) in some regions. Strong analytical thinking, attention to detail, and effective teamwork skills set top performers apart in this field. These competencies are crucial for ensuring the design, maintenance, and optimization of electronic systems meet technical and safety standards.

What is the difference between Electronics Engineering Technologist vs Electronics Engineering Technician?

AspectElectronics Engineering TechnologistElectronics Engineering Technician
CredentialsDiploma or degree in electronics engineering technologyDiploma or certificate in electronics technology
Work EnvironmentDesign, testing, and troubleshooting in labs or officesInstallation, maintenance, and repair in field or shop settings
Employer & IndustryManufacturers, engineering firms, R&D departmentsTelecommunications, electronics repair shops, manufacturing

The main difference between an Electronics Engineering Technologist and an Electronics Engineering Technician lies in their roles and responsibilities. Technologists typically focus on designing, testing, and developing electronic systems, often requiring a higher level of education. Technicians usually handle installation, maintenance, and troubleshooting tasks. Both roles are essential in the electronics industry, with overlapping skills but distinct functions.
